STAPLES v. UNITED STATES

No. 17554.

327 F.2d 860 (1963)

William A. STAPLES, Appellant, v. UNITED STATES of America,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ided December 12, 1963.

Certiorari Denied March 23, 1964.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Josiah Lyman, Washington, D. C., with whom Mr. William J. Garber, Washington, D. C., was on the brief, for appellant.

Mr. Gerald A. Messerman, Asst. U. S. Atty., with whom Messrs. David C. Acheson, U. S. Atty., Frank Q. Nebeker and Victor W. Caputy, Asst. U. S. Attys., were on the brief, for appellee.

Before BAZELON, Chief Judge, and FAHY and WRIGHT, Circuit Judges.


Certiorari Denied March 23, 1964. See 84 S.Ct. 978.

PER CURIAM.

The search which resulted in obtaining evidence introduced at the trial over objection was incidental to an arrest for violation of the narcotic laws. This arrest was made on probable cause and, therefore, was valid.
